Alpine deck freezing

My Alpine 7894 has started freezing lately. It's weird, the deck will power on and look like it's working but none of the buttons will work and nothing will play. If I leave it, sometimes it will start playing music after a while. Other times, I'll turn the car on, it will work and then I'll turn the car off, run into a store, come back to the car and it will be in "freeze" mode again. It's very hit and miss. I've cleaned the connectors on the faceplate but that doesn't seem to make any difference. I've also hit the reset button on the deck. Any one have any ideas or encountered this before? Or is my deck just finally dying of old age.

clean the contacts on the faceplate. and on the head unit. make sure the key is off, use some isopropyl alcohol and a qtip.. if you smoke alot of weed use a pencil eraser as well.
